STADIUM NOTES

     A study paid for by the Northwest Indiana Chicagoland
Entertainment Inc., the group attempting to lure the Bears to
Gary, "pegs the cost of cleaning up contaminated soil and water
and restoring damaged wetlands" area on the site at no more than
$11.5M (CRAINS CHICAGO BUSINESS, 12/11 issue).... Arkansas AD
Frank Broyles has been contacted by Cowboys Owner Jerry Jones
regarding a position as Jones' personal representative on his
stadium project and theme park (DALLAS MORNING NEWS,
12/9)....More than 90% of the $100M debt assumed to build the
Texas Motor Speedway will be paid by track developer Bruton Smith
(FT. WORTH STAR TELEGRAM, 12/9)....     The Lions "could decide
this month to terminate their relationship" with the Silverdome,
"and return to Motown" ("Fox NFL Sunday," 12/10).
